Description
Read the first alarm distance
Read the first alarm distance
Change the first alarm distance:
Adjustment range = 0.00 ... 100.00
Read the second alarm distance
Change the second alarm distance:
Adjustment range = 0.00 ... 100.00
Read the alarm hysteresis value
Change the alarm hysteresis value:
Adjustment range = 0.00 ... 10.00
Check which measuring mode (update rate) is active
Change to a new measuring mode (update rate):
1 = 388 readings per second
2 = 194 readings per second
3 = 129 readings per second
4 = 97 readings per second
5 = 78 readings per second
6 = 65 readings per second
7 = 55 readings per second
8 = 48 readings per second
Check if the laser is running
Change the laser state:
0 = laser is off
1 = laser is running
Read the internal temperature
Read the level of background noise
Check the laser encoding pattern
Change the laser encoding pattern:
0 = no encoding pattern
1 = pattern A
2 = pattern B
3 = pattern C
4 = pattern D
Read the number of lost signal confirmations
Change the number of lost signal confirmations:
Adjustment range = 1 .... 250
Read the gain boost value
Change the gain boost value:
Adjustment range = -20.00 ... 5.00
Save all Laser channel settings
Servo channel commands
Check if a servo is connected
Check if a servo is connected
Connect the servo
Check if the servo is scanning
Turn on servo scanning
Stream servo scanning data:
ss:angle, first return, last return
Read the current servo position in degrees
Move the servo to a new position:
Adjustment range = -180 ... 180
Read the current servo position in degrees
Move the servo to the middle position
Read the minimum allowed PWM time in us
Change the minimum allowed PWM time:
Adjustment range = 0.0 ... 2999.0
Read the maximum allowed PWM time in us
Change the maximum allowed PWM time:
Adjustment range = 0.0 ... 2999.0
Read the us per degree scale of the servo
Change the us per degree scale of the servo:
Adjustment range = 0.1 ... 1000.0
